Web"rake" in Spanish rake {noun} inclinación - hurgón - rastrillo - calavera - disoluto - escoba metálica - raqueta - vividor - caída - rastrillado to rake {transitive verb} rastrillar - barrer - … WebFeb 12, 2024 · ”Hola” (OH-la) means hello in Spanish. Other common greetings include “buenos días” (booEHN-os DEE-as), which means “good morning,” and “buenas noches” (booEHN-ahs NO-chehs), which means “good evening.” Following a hello, you may say “¿Cómo estás?” (KOH-moh ess-TAHS), which means "How are you?"
